Output d53f19eaa52a193e6283a1aa8afeb77cafd1c5f0f1d790282b9ba08acf3c3c48:106

value
1594323
script pubkey
OP_0 OP_PUSHBYTES_20 43cb9ba749e76b068dfba77089fa835267076f16
address
bc1qg09ehf6fua4sdr0m5acgn75r2fnswmckcjm5fw
transaction
d53f19eaa52a193e6283a1aa8afeb77cafd1c5f0f1d790282b9ba08acf3c3c48